/**
|
||||
* Normalize to a Unix-style path, replacing backslashes (interpreted as
|
||||
* separators only on Windows) with forward slashes (interpreted as
|
||||
* separators everywhere)
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@param {String} path
|
||||
* @return {String}
|
||||
*/
|
||||
this.normalizeToUnix = function (path) {
|
||||
// If we're on Windows, we need to normalize first and then replace
|
||||
// the slashes, because OS.Path.normalize won't handle forward slashes
|
||||
// correctly. Otherwise, we replace slashes first and *then* normalize.
|
||||
// This should ensure consistent behavior across platforms.
|
||||
if (Zotero.isWin) {
|
||||
let normalized = OS.Path.normalize(path);
|
||||
return normalized.replace(/\\/g, '/');
|
||||
}
|
||||
else {
|
||||
let replaced = path.replace(/\\/g, '/');
|
||||
return OS.Path.normalize(replaced);
|
||||
}
|
||||
};

/**
|
||||
* Attempt to find a file in the LABD matching the passed attachment
|
||||
* by searching successive subdirectories. Prompt the user if a match is
|
||||
* found and offer to relink one or all matching files in the directory.
|
||||
* The user can also choose to relink manually, which opens a file picker.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* If the synced path is 'C:\Users\user\Documents\Dissertation\Files\Paper.pdf',
|
||||
* the LABD is '/Users/user/Documents', and the (not yet known) correct local
|
||||
* path is '/Users/user/Documents/Dissertation/Files/Paper.pdf', check:
|
||||
*
|
||||
* 1. /Users/user/Documents/Users/user/Documents/Dissertation/Files/Paper.pdf
|
||||
* 2. /Users/user/Documents/user/Documents/Dissertation/Files/Paper.pdf
|
||||
* 3. /Users/user/Documents/Documents/Dissertation/Files/Paper.pdf
|
||||
* 4. /Users/user/Documents/Dissertation/Files/Paper.pdf
|
||||
*
|
||||
* If line 4 had not been the correct local path (in other words, if no file
|
||||
* existed at that path), we would have continued on to check
|
||||
* '/Users/user/Documents/Dissertation/Paper.pdf'. If that did not match,
|
||||
* with no more segments in the synced path to drop, we would have given up.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Once we find the file, check for other linked files beginning with
|
||||
* C:\Users\user\Documents\Dissertation\Files and see if they exist relative
|
||||
* to /Users/user/Documents/Dissertation/Files, and prompt to relink them
|
||||
* all if so.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@param {Zotero.Item} item
|
||||
* @return {Promise<Boolean>} True if relinked successfully or canceled
|
||||
*/
